About the course

Bioinformatics plays a crucial role in extracting valuable insights from data, enabling a deeper understanding of human diseases and facilitating the discovery of new molecular targets and therapeutic agents for drug development. Graduates will acquire the expertise to address real-world life science challenges through informatics and computational approaches.The programme provides three flexible pathways after Year Two, tailored to individual interests: continue bioinformatics at XJTLU with an emphasis on computational elements; pursue traditional molecular bioscience modules at XJTLU, focusing on lab-based and biological content; or study those modules at the University of Liverpool in the UK, highlighting lab-based work.
